采用碱性水电解法并设计了相应的由氧化铁直接制备金属铁的实验装置.将氧化铁粉末压制成圆形薄片(Φ10 mm×1.6 mm),空气气氛下烧结后作为阴极,石墨碳棒作阳极.以质量分数50%的NaOH溶液为电解质,电解温度110℃,电解电压1.6V,电解时间1~5h.产物经过SEM、EDX和XRD等分析表明:通过碱性水电解可以直接制备得到金属铁.电解反应过程分两步进行,先由Fe2O3生成Fe3O4,然后再由Fe3O4得到金属铁.
